Why Location Knowledge Actually Matters Here

Appliance repair in Denver isn't the same trade it is at sea level.

At roughly 5,280 feet, gas burns leaner than it does almost anywhere else in the country. A Wolf range or a Viking cooktop calibrated for Chicago or Dallas will run rich up here — uneven flame, sluggish oven preheat, a pilot that won't hold. We recalibrate for altitude as a matter of course, not as an upsell, because a tech who skips that step hasn't actually fixed the appliance; they've just replaced a part and left the underlying mismatch in place.

Then there's the water. Denver's Front Range supply runs hard, and hard water is unglamorous but relentless — it scales up ice maker lines, dishwasher spray arms, steam oven boilers, and the inlet valves on nearly every water-using appliance we touch. In a Cherry Creek North rowhome with an original built-in refrigeration column, we'll often find twenty years of mineral buildup doing more damage than any single failed component. We descale what needs it and talk through filtration options that actually make sense for your unit, rather than a generic upsell.

None of this requires guesswork on our part, because we've been doing it in these specific neighborhoods long enough to recognize the pattern before we even open the panel.

Estate Kitchens Get Estate-Level Attention

Cherry Hills Village and Country Club homes tend to run appliance packages, not single units — a 48-inch range paired with a warming drawer, a full-height wine column, sometimes two refrigeration units working in tandem for entertaining season. When one component in that ecosystem falters, we look at the whole system, because a warming drawer running hot can sometimes trace back to ventilation shared with a nearby oven.

That's a different kind of job than a single dishwasher repair in a Glendale condo, and we staff and schedule accordingly, giving estate calls the extended time window they genuinely need.

Do you deal with issues specific to Denver's altitude and water?

Yes. Denver's roughly 5,280-foot elevation means gas appliances often need altitude recalibration that out-of-town techs miss, and the Front Range's hard water scales up ice makers and water valves over time — both are routine parts of how we diagnose and repair.
